The winners: Women in NSW local government awards

 NSW Minister for Local Government, Gabrielle Upton.

 

 

The female superstars of NSW local government were honoured by the NSW Minister for Local Government Gabrielle Upton and the Minister for Women Tanya Davies ahead of International Women’s Day today (Wednesday).

The tenth annual awards ceremony at Parliament House last night marked the impressive achievements of women at local councils up and down the state, in metropolitan, rural and regional areas.

Awards are for councillors and for council staff.

 

The Winners

 

 Elected Representative from a Metropolitan Council
•           Winner: Councillor Jennifer Anderson, Ku-ring-gai Council

Special Achievement Award
•           Councillor Judith Rutherford AM, Willoughby City Council

Elected Representative from a Rural or Regional Council
•           Winner: Councillor Kristy McBain, Bega Valley Shire Council
•           Highly Commended: Councillor Jenny Clarke, Narrandera Shire Council

Senior Staff Member – Metropolitan Council
•           Winner: Julie Vaughan, Central Coast Council
•           Highly Commended: Marissa Racomelara, Georges River Council
•           Highly Commended: Gail Connolly, Georges River Council

Senior Staff Member – Rural or Regional Council
•           Winner: Margot Stork, Murray River Council

Non-Senior Staff Member – Metropolitan Council
•           Winner: Petrina Nelson, City of Canada Bay Council
•           Highly Commended: Adama Kamara, Cumberland Council

Non-Senior Staff Member – Rural or Regional Council
•           Winner: Debra Hilton, Gunnedah Shire Council

Women in a Non-Traditional Role – Metropolitan Council
•           Winner: Martina Fletcher, Blacktown City Council
•           Highly Commended: Kelly Loveridge, Inner West Council

Women in a Non-Traditional Role – Rural or Regional Council
•           Winner: Megan Cone, Armidale Regional Council
•           Highly Commended: Maree Brennan, Kyogle Council
